Commit Graph

1226 Commits

Author SHA1 Message Date
Federico Terzi
a70d9b6770 fix(render): fix clippy warnings 2022-02-13 14:53:14 +01:00
Federico Terzi
ca8ca3001d fix(render): override PATH env variable on macOS to mitigate differences in shell extension executions. Fix #966 2022-02-13 13:23:08 +01:00
Federico Terzi
115e2f2138 fix(ci): upgrade Ubuntu Dockerfile rust version 2022-02-08 22:04:36 +01:00
Federico Terzi
c09e85ba85 feat(core): log when modulo exits with non-zero code. Fix #944 2022-02-08 21:31:54 +01:00
Federico Terzi
e304192dbd chore(misc): version bump 2022-02-08 21:09:37 +01:00
Federico Terzi
cd9f26ce3e feat(ci): set up Homebrew release CI. #897 2022-01-12 21:46:06 +01:00
Federico Terzi
54bfed4c11 fix(ci): fix CI YAML indentation error 2022-01-12 21:42:24 +01:00
Federico Terzi
ff693dd998 feat(misc): add test action to publish homebrew cask 2022-01-12 21:40:47 +01:00
Federico Terzi
50a67baf03 feat(misc): add scripts to publish homebrew cask 2022-01-12 21:27:40 +01:00
Federico Terzi
b5ac6b85c5 fix(core): upgrade deb gtk version to 3 2022-01-10 22:46:12 +01:00
Federico Terzi
86632e38e6 fix(ci): fix wrong artifacts name 2022-01-10 21:42:45 +01:00
Federico Terzi
29f079729f fix(ci): fix debian package build error 2022-01-10 21:23:40 +01:00
Federico Terzi
3a6bd4f01e fix(ci): use fixed version of cargo-deb to avoid missing Rust 2021 crash 2022-01-10 21:04:47 +01:00
Federico Terzi
50f70b2ba5 fix(ci): fix wrong step name 2022-01-10 21:04:20 +01:00
Federico Terzi
671fd3c532 feat(misc): implement Deb package building pipeline. Fix #932 2022-01-10 20:53:56 +01:00
Federico Terzi
d7ee3b3833 fix(core): remove unused warning 2022-01-10 20:49:30 +01:00
Federico Terzi
85b8a90913 fix(core): remove paste_shortcut and backend override from Thunderbird patch. Fix #455 2022-01-10 19:19:00 +01:00
Federico Terzi
f07d297ce0 feat(core): wire up additional search terms and fix multiple triggers search. Fix #796 Fix #789 2022-01-04 21:19:09 +01:00
Federico Terzi
b31617a2f3 feat(config): add search terms option. #789 #796 2022-01-04 21:18:17 +01:00
Federico Terzi
90be91d1e9 feat(modulo): implement additional search items. #789 2022-01-04 21:17:09 +01:00
Federico Terzi
35ed59bd23 fix(config): disable 'search_trigger' by default. Fix #925 2022-01-04 20:33:28 +01:00
Federico Terzi
a143d951f8 fix(core): fix SecureInput troubleshoot link. Fix #892 2022-01-03 21:38:06 +01:00
Federico Terzi
fe5c9cf19d fix(engine): capitalize Espanso inside context menu 2022-01-03 21:37:39 +01:00
Federico Terzi
697f51e210 feat(inject): wire up inject_delay on macOS. Fix #849 2022-01-03 20:36:58 +01:00
Federico Terzi
7588900c06 feat(espanso): clarify 'espanso service' usage. Fix #920 2021-12-29 20:44:02 +01:00
Federico Terzi
68e2698a9c chore(misc): version bump 2021-12-28 20:38:33 +01:00
Federico Terzi
a9f4cc1edf feat(config): disable toggle_key by default. Fix #916 2021-12-27 18:33:42 +01:00
Federico Terzi
8d0efc6436 chore(misc): remove legacy packager script 2021-12-25 23:20:36 +01:00
Federico Terzi
1f0761d140 fix(misc): remove hardcoded glib library inside AppImage. #900 2021-12-25 13:44:23 +01:00
Federico Terzi
9801b09ab6 feat(core): wire up choice extension. #850 2021-12-21 22:49:11 +01:00
Federico Terzi
873c70a248 feat(render): implement choice extension. #850 2021-12-21 22:48:10 +01:00
Federico Terzi
b2e6a8c8cc fix(modulo): fix form return key shortcut not working when ListBox component was selected. Fix #857 2021-12-21 21:32:31 +01:00
Federico Terzi
06f990fbd7 fix(misc): use appimage-extract-and-run option to (hopefully) enable appimagetool on Docker 2021-12-21 21:09:24 +01:00
Federico Terzi
92b85427ed fix(core): switch Wayland to the SHIFT+INSERT paste combination by default. Fix #899 2021-12-21 20:59:37 +01:00
Federico Terzi
08483e73b1 fix(misc): apply workaround to hopefully solve #900 2021-12-21 20:46:25 +01:00
Federico Terzi
d4d7609dd8 fix(clipboard): fix clippy warning 2021-12-13 23:53:09 +01:00
Federico Terzi
243c6604f8 fix(config): fix clippy warning 2021-12-13 23:52:57 +01:00
Federico Terzi
37893a3f74 fix(render): fix clippy warning 2021-12-13 23:08:00 +01:00
Federico Terzi
1e92cfef5c fix(misc): fix new clippy warnings 2021-12-11 18:19:56 +01:00
Federico Terzi
88b9c2ae03 fix(inject): fix clippy warning 2021-12-11 17:25:30 +01:00
Federico Terzi
bd2abeb8de fix(match): fix clippy warning 2021-12-11 17:25:18 +01:00
Federico Terzi
c23d99311a fix(ci): add explicit rust-script version to app-image build 2021-12-11 17:02:03 +01:00
Federico Terzi
38b4d437f3 fix(ci): install explicit rust-script version to mitigate CI failure: https://github.com/fornwall/rust-script/issues/42 2021-12-11 16:31:57 +01:00
Federico Terzi
f062a8ec35 fix(misc): explicitly add libglib dependency to (hopefully) mitigate #900 2021-12-11 16:26:11 +01:00
Federico Terzi
bf1d184ae9 feat(core): stop espanso when removing snap. #464 2021-12-11 11:36:16 +01:00
Federico Terzi
de1fefba51 fix(core): add patch for brave browser. Fix #876 2021-12-06 22:50:15 +01:00
Federico Terzi
74c5e5ae86 fix(clipboard): fix wrong xclip call. #885 2021-12-04 10:42:53 +01:00
Federico Terzi
50904c2d2b chore(misc): version bump 2021-12-04 10:42:19 +01:00
Federico Terzi
73214cb59a fix(inject): improve X11 injector to handle dead keys. Fix #881 2021-11-22 22:54:44 +01:00
Federico Terzi
57b2f194e5 fix(inject): attempt setting explicit coregraphics dependency to fix compilation on macOS 11.6 2021-11-21 20:57:05 +01:00